Select Committee on Land Access

TERMS OF REFERENCE
That this House establish a Select Committee to inquire into and report upon:
(a) Land access regimes as they relate to mining and mining exploration under the Mining Act
1971, the Opal Mining Act 1995 and the Petroleum and Geothermal Energy Act 2000.

(b) Such operations of the Department for Energy and Mining as may relate to, or be affected
by, land access regimes;

(c) The practices of interstate and overseas jurisdictions as they relate to balancing the rights
of landowners and those seeking to access land in order to explore for or exploit minerals,
precious stones or regulated substances;

(d) Administrative and legislative options that may help achieve a best practice model in South
Australia that balances the rights of landowners and those seeking to access land to explore
for or exploit minerals, precious stones or regulated substances;

(e) Measures that should be implemented to achieve a best practice model in South Australia
that balances the rights of landowners and those seeking to access land to explore for or
exploit minerals, precious stones or regulated substances (to the extent that such measures
are not being addressed through existing programs or initiatives); and

(f) Any other related matter
